What's the role
The Process Engineer is tasked with remote technical monitoring and process performance reporting support being a part of the extended Process Engineering team.
Plant performance monitoring and plant performance improvement on key performance aspects such as process safety, manufacturing reliability, energy efficiency, yield improvement, and capacity expansion are key areas where process engineer is expected to contribute.
What you'll be doing
The key accountability of the Process Engineer is providing support of the technical content for their respective technology or theme area. Performs technical monitoring of the process technology against the safe operating envelope and limits for the process unit(s) that reside within their technology or theme area base. Audits and supports technical content development and other unit performance KPI’s to assure the operation is compliant. The purpose of this activity is to understand unit and equipment performance, identify threats, troubleshoot performance and reliability gaps, and identify opportunities for improvement. This activity feeds into multiple deliverables.
Provides inputs and guidance to the OSE’s/CSE’s assigned to the physical assets to ensure their assigned assets are operated in a safe, environmentally sound and reliable manner in accordance with the license to operate and the defined safe operating envelope.
Maintains up to date technology specific knowledge through LFI, technical networks etc. so as to be able to proactively identify threats to the units or business coming from the wider Shell organization or industry knowledge and practices.
Identify opportunities to improve unit capacity, yield, availability and utilization in support of the site and business plans.
Participates in technology forums, conferences to share learning and maintain and improve competencies in their specialty.
Maintains and help’s develop training materials and guidance manuals designed for Engineers in conjunction with P&T and Learning.
Specific activities can include (but not limited to):
Generate and review unit KPI dashboards, and to raise awareness on, create response plans and discuss risks as part of the continuous unit proactive monitoring.
Identifies and discusses Threats & Opportunities
Collaborate to build monthly reports which capture short, medium, and long term perspectives for future learning.
Actively participates in the ESP Process through leading Alarm Review meetings and engaging in Console Review meetings with Production PTMs and sharing unit status updates / escalating issues in daily unit PE Huddle meetings.
Assists Production and Maintenance with troubleshooting process issues and may escalate to UE for additional support.
Owns, develops, selects and implements solutions to operational and / or customer centric risks and opportunities for smaller scope using OPEX related MOCs.
Provides monthly, quarterly and annual input for production accounting and regulatory reporting (i.e. Solomon, yield reporting, flaring, chemical costs, etc).
Identifying violations of the Operating Window, IOW and DOW
Developing of proposals to address identified immediate threats
Detailed root-cause analysis of abnormalities
Developing of proposals to optimize units

What you bring
Preferably with a bachelor’s or master’s degree in chemical engineering
Proven experience in a chemical complex or a refining facility.
Knowledge of one or more of the following technologies: Continuous Catalytic cracking, Platforming, Hydro processing, Distillation.
Ability to analyze, troubleshoot, and resolve asset problems with maintenance and operations.
Utilization of problem-solving techniques to resolve design & engineering issues.
Knowledge of integration between process units
Experience using industry standard process simulation software
Problem solving skills - knowledge of engineering Standards and best practices.
Understanding fundamentals of flow measurement technology, basic mass and energy balance
Experience in data quality assurance checks, troubleshooting and statistics
FIM investigation, MOC knowledge.
